A decrease in the magnitude of velocity is called

<span>The answer is deceleration. Acceleration is the general term to refer to the change in velocity. Acceleration = change in velocity / change in time. When you want to highlight the fact that the change in velocity is a decrease in the magnitude, you can use the term deceleration, which means that the acceleration is negative.</span>

What mass of O2 is needed to completely react with 500 g of Fe

4Fe +3O2------------>2Fe2O3

4mole. 3mole. 2 mole

224g. 96g. 320g

we have

224 g of fe needed to react completely with 96 g of O2

500g of fe needed to react completely with

96 ×500/224=214.3g of O2

214.3g of O2 is a required answer.
